Message type: E = Error
Message class: /SAPCE/IU_ARCH_MSG -
Message number: 003
Message text: Archiving process is interrupted. There are no data.

/SAPCE/IU_ARCH_MSG003 Archiving process is interrupted. There are no data.
typically indicates that the archiving process was initiated, but there were no data records available for archiving in the specified selection criteria. This can happen for several reasons, and understanding the cause can help in resolving the issue.Causes:
- No Data Available: The most straightforward reason is that there are simply no records that meet the criteria specified for archiving.
- Selection Criteria: The selection criteria used in the archiving job may be too restrictive, leading to no data being selected for archiving.
- Data Already Archived: The data you are trying to archive may have already been archived in a previous run.
- Incorrect Configuration: There may be issues with the configuration of the archiving object or the archiving process itself.
- Authorization Issues: The user executing the archiving process may not have the necessary authorizations to access the data.
Solutions:
- Check Selection Criteria: Review the selection criteria used in the archiving job. Ensure that they are set correctly and that there are indeed records that meet these criteria.
- Verify Data Availability: Use transaction codes like
SARA
to check if there are any records available for archiving. You can also run a report to see if there are records that meet the archiving conditions.- Review Previous Archiving Runs: Check if the data has already been archived in previous runs. You can do this by reviewing the archiving logs.
- Configuration Check: Ensure that the archiving object is correctly configured. This includes checking the settings in transaction
SARA
for the specific archiving object.- Authorization Check: Verify that the user has the necessary authorizations to perform the archiving process. This can be done by checking the user roles and authorizations in the system.
-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to the specific archiving object you are working with for any additional troubleshooting steps or known issues.
Related Information:
SARA
: Archive AdministrationSARI
: Archive Information SystemSARCH
: Archive Object ManagementBy following these steps, you should be able to identify the cause of the error and take appropriate action to resolve it. If the issue persists, consider reaching out to SAP support for further assistance.
